Leptospirosis in a dog is a bacterial zoonotic disease that is not just limited to dogs, in fact, this disease affects practically all mammals and has a broad range of clinical outcome

Leptospirosis in dogs is caused by bacteria that belong to the genus Leptospira. Currently, 2 species of Leptospira have been identified. These are

1- Leptospira interrogans

2-ย Leptospira biflexa
